President Donald Trump stated that he could end the war between Russia and Ukraine in a short period, suggesting that Vladimir Putin would be interested in resuming economic relations with the United States. In an interview with CBS News, Trump claimed that peace could be achieved in a few months, relying on Moscow's desire to cooperate economically with Washington.
He emphasized that during his term, he managed to resolve eight conflicts through economic pressure, but he treated the war in Ukraine differently, considering that trade relations with Russia are limited. Trump also stated that he does not intend to allow the delivery of Tomahawk missiles to Ukraine for attacks on Russian territory, although he left open the possibility of reconsidering in the future.
